I would like to build a raised garden bed to plant vegetables and I know you don't usually till the ground first, but I have clay soil. Should I till the ground first? |
You won't have to till it but digging it up to break the surface will eliminate a barrier between the clay soil and the topsoil you place in your raised bed. If you don't break the soil surface the clay will act like concrete and slow water drainage. Just rough it up with a shovel and everything will be fine. Enjoy your new garden! |
